Kick Off Your Holiday Deliciousness At Macy's With Chef Ming Tsai

Posted on 06:50 by suresh kumar
I don't know about you, but the holidays bring out this excitement in me that includes the desire to cook up some pretty awesome things for my family and friends. Nothing impresses them more than when I whip up some holiday favorites that make their taste buds tingle.

Chef Ming Tsai

One way I'll be adding some pizzazz to my table this season is by learning some new recipes and tips from award winning restaurateur, author, television personality and celebrity chef Ming Tsai at Macy's Culinary Council demonstration taking place on Friday, December 12th at 6:30 p.m., at the Macy's Dadeland Mall Culinary Kitchen (2nd floor). I love attending these events because not only do you get to chat and interact with talented chefs you already admire, but you also get to sample some of their scrumptious food while you're doing it.

Another plus? Macy's offers some great incentives during these events. Purchase $35 or more in the Home Department and receive a $10 Macy's gift card and a copy of Chef Ming Tsai's book Simply Ming In Your Kitchen, which he will sign for you.**  I know where I'll be buying my new kitchen gadgets this weekend.

Seating is limited and on a first come, first served basis so you should definitely RSVP. This is going to be a very popular event and you don't want to miss it. Your guests will be talking about you all year when you're done cooking... and in a good way. Hope to see you there...
